Abstract
A radio frequency switch circuit with improved harmonic suppression and low insertion loss has an antenna port and a plurality of signal ports. A plurality of transistor switch circuits, are connected to a respective one of the plurality of signal ports and to the antenna port. Each of the transistor switch circuits has a transistor, which in an off state, together with a harmonic suppression capacitor and a parallel inductor both connected thereto, define a tank circuit that suppresses RF signals applied to the corresponding transistor switch circuit from a different one of the transistor switch circuits. The harmonic suppression capacitor is tuned to distribute large signal voltage swings in the RE signal amongst parasitic diodes of the transistor.

31. An antenna switch circuit, comprising:
-
an antenna port; a plurality of signal ports; a plurality of transistors each including a gate, a source, a drain, and a body, the source of each of the plurality of transistors being connected to a respective one of the signal ports and the drain of each of the plurality of transistors being connected to the antenna port; a plurality of harmonic suppression capacitors each connected to the body and to the drain of each of the plurality of transistors; and a plurality of parallel inductors each connected to the source and to the drain of each of the plurality of transistors. - View Dependent Claims (32, 33, 34, 35)
